News summary

Justin Flavien, a 22-year-old man from Maywood, New Jersey, has been arrested and extradited to Broward County, Florida, for allegedly making multiple swatting calls in Parkland. These incidents occurred in August 2024, with false reports of shootings, including claims of a hostage situation and a shooting involving a sister. Despite efforts to hide his identity using various technologies and phone numbers, Flavien was identified by the Broward Sheriff's Office in collaboration with the Maywood Police Department. Investigators discovered that Flavien may have conducted similar hoaxes across the country. He faces charges including making a false report concerning a bomb, explosive, or weapon of mass destruction and using a two-way communication device to further a felony offense. Authorities recovered multiple electronic devices from his home during the investigation.
